Yet many drivers overlook a feature designed precisely for these moments. Most modern vehicles are equipped with a dedicated windshield defrost function. When activated, it directs warm air toward the glass while simultaneously engaging the air-conditioning system. This combination matters: heat loosens the ice, while dry air reduces moisture, allowing frost to clear faster and fogging to stay away. Using it is straightforward.
